Easy Cherry Danish Tart Recipe Video
Ingredients
| Whole wheat flour | 6 Ounce | |
| Cold butter | 6 Tablespoon (Ice Cold) | |
| Salt | 1⁄2 Teaspoon | |
| Sugar | 1 Teaspoon | |
| Ice water | 1⁄4 Cup (4 tbs) | |
| Orange juice/Plain vodka | 1 Tablespoon (Ice Cold) | |
| Cherry pie filling | 1 Cup (16 tbs) |

Directions
1) Preheat oven to temperature of 350 degrees.
MAKING
2) Mix together the whole wheat flour, sugar, salt and butter. Use a pastry cutter and cut the butter into the mixture.
3) Mix together the vodka and ice water.
4) Add the liquid mixture to the pie crust mixture.
5) Make a loose, flaky dough.
6) Wrap the dough in plastic and place it in the fridge for 2 hours.
7) Remove the dough from the fridge, unwrap it and sprinkle some flour over it.
8) Roll out the dough on a floured surface and remove the rough edges.
9) Place the dough on parchment paper and place the cherry pie filling on it.
10) Fold the crust up towards the center. Leave some inches open in the center.
11) Glaze the dough with some milk and sprinkle a generous amount of white sugar on top.
12) Bake in the preheated oven for 40 minutes. When the crust is brown all over and the center is bubbling, the folditup is done.
13) Let the pastry sit at room temperature till it is cool and then slice it.
SERVING
14) Serve the preparation at room temperature or chilled. Makes an excellent dessert.
